Artist Biography

Karlalise Horstmans is an artist and former intellectual property lawyer. She is based in Auckland, New Zealand. She paints across a wide range of scales (40cm - 4m) and sculpts in mixed media. Her works are consistently selected to appear in major national and international art awards. One of her latest figurative works received recognition in the Hope & Sons Art Awards 2026.

Artist Statement

Karlalise's practice is grounded in (highly sensitive) perception, observation, presence and contemplation. She investigates chromatic complexity and spatial ambiguity, building low saturation layers with nuanced chroma to make contemplative works that explore themes of the everyday (observing social and built environments), stillness, the self and sacred presence or the sublime.
